What are ROA telling us?
The Return on Assets (ROA) ratio measures how profitable a company is relative to its total assets. OceanFirst Financial Corp. (OCFC) currently has a ROA of 0.48%. Companies that manage their assets effectively will have greater returns, while those that do so poorly would suffer lower returns.
